    Number 1 injector failed. The sound was most likely from deadheading the fuel to an injector the wouldn't open. Replacing the injector solved the issue.

    Power Motive, in Denver, is a Bosch certified test station. The injectors were manufactured by Bosch for Cummins, so I consider myself lucky to have that resource close to home. The fuel should atomize when the injector fires from six holes per injector. If it doesn't atomize, it won't burn.

    glad yours was an injector....if any of you have that knock with no miss and lots of blowby ,and the knock doesn't go away after kill testing injectors ....probably collapsed ,galled ,scored,piston... fixing 1 like that now .
